Output 85c204dd61eecdec1ebb2b7342a3155d316a61dca8edabdc52da9c66c86f2b4e:25

value
53435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ec1d9446125f0ca480773a7e40702cf45532e08 OP_EQUAL
address
37Qr3HFb8VPyVDpwX29qsKqrmMvwTg6uxy
transaction
85c204dd61eecdec1ebb2b7342a3155d316a61dca8edabdc52da9c66c86f2b4e
confirmations
19756
spent
false